Listing on the Exchange Sample Clauses

Listing on the Exchange. The Borrower's common shares shall remain listed on the Exchange and the Borrower shall comply in all material respects with the rules and policies of such exchange and all applicable securities laws, rules and regulations.

Listing on the Exchange. The Rights and the Seritage Common Shares shall have been accepted for listing on the Exchange, subject to official notice of issuance.
Listing on the Exchange. The Units are validly listed on the Exchange, and the Company is not aware of any violation of any listing requirements or any current or threatened action for delisting.
Listing on the Exchange. DT undertakes to abstain from any action that results in the delisting of the OTE Shares from the Exchange throughout the Term, unless required under the applicable legislation.
Listing on the Exchange. Ocean Rig UDW Inc. shall be listed on the Exchange by 30 September 2011 and will remain listed and will not delist without the prior written consent of the Lenders. 56(105)
Listing on the Exchange. Prior to delivery of the first Placement Notice, the Shares will be validly listed on the Exchange, and the Company is not aware of any violation of any listing requirements or any current or threatened action for delisting.

  • Listing on Nasdaq The Shares will be approved for listing on the Nasdaq Capital Market (“Nasdaq”) by the Closing Date, subject to official notice of issuance, and the Company has taken no action designed to, or likely to have the effect of, terminating the listing of the Securities on Nasdaq nor has the Company received any notification that Nasdaq is contemplating revoking or withdrawing approval for listing of the Securities.

  • Listing on the Nasdaq Capital Market The Company will use commercially reasonable efforts to maintain the listing of the Public Securities on the Nasdaq Capital Market or another national securities exchange until the earlier of five (5) years from the Effective Date or until the Public Securities are no longer registered under the Exchange Act.

  • Listing on an Exchange If the Debentures are distributed to the holders of the Securities issued by the Trust, and the Preferred Securities are then so listed, the Company will use its best efforts to list such Debentures on the New York Stock Exchange, Inc. or on such other exchange as the Preferred Securities are then listed.

  • Trading of the Public Securities on the Nasdaq Capital Market As of the Effective Date and the Closing Date, the Public Securities will have been authorized for listing on the Nasdaq Capital Market and no proceedings have been instituted or threatened which would effect, and no event or circumstance has occurred as of the Effective Date which is reasonably likely to effect, the listing of the Public Securities on the Nasdaq Capital Market.

  • Listing on Securities Exchange If the General Partner lists or maintains the listing of REIT Shares on any securities exchange or national market system, it shall, at its expense and as necessary to permit the registration and sale of the Redemption Shares hereunder, list thereon, maintain and, when necessary, increase such listing to include such Redemption Shares.

  • Listing on Securities Exchanges If the Common Stock is listed on a stock exchange or quoted on the Nasdaq National Market, the Company will use its reasonable best efforts to procure at its sole expense the listing of all Warrant Shares (subject to issuance or notice of issuance) on all stock exchanges on which the Common Stock is then listed, or the quotation of the Warrant Shares on the Nasdaq National Market, as the case may be, and maintain the listing or quotation of such shares and other securities after issuance.

  • Nasdaq National Market Listing Parent shall authorize for listing on the Nasdaq National Market the shares of Parent Common Stock issuable, and those required to be reserved for issuance, in connection with the Merger, upon official notice of issuance.

  • Nasdaq National Market The Common Stock is registered pursuant to Section 12(b) of the Exchange Act and is listed on the Nasdaq National Market ("Nasdaq"), and, except as contemplated by this Agreement, the Company has taken no action designed to, or likely to have the effect of, terminating the registration of the Common Stock under the Exchange Act or delisting the Common Stock from Nasdaq, nor has the Company received any notification that the SEC or the National Association of Securities Dealers, Inc. ("NASD") is contemplating terminating such registration or listing.
